Yet another miracle of modern science is presented in a parody of the "Lee Press-On Nails" ads.
No reviews found.
Release Date: 1989-05-16
Vote Average: 7.912
Media Type: movie
Release Date: 2024-12-25
Vote Average: 7.6
Release Date: 2023-03-21
Vote Average: 10
Release Date: 1939-12-28
Vote Average: 5
Release Date: 1979-01-01
Vote Average: 5.2
Release Date: 2021-12-30
Vote Average: 9.8
Release Date: 1972-06-15
Release Date: 2022-01-28
Vote Average: 4
Release Date: 1999-01-01
Release Date: 2025-03-16
Vote Average: 8
keyboard_arrow_up